What it does not do
Every tool in this category makes absolute claims. Ours are stated as limits instead.
Windows only
There is no macOS or Linux build. The capture-protection API it relies on is unavailable on some older Windows builds, and the app tells you when that is the case rather than failing quietly.
Capture behaviour varies
It depends on your operating system, sharing mode, meeting app, graphics path, recording method and any enterprise policy in place. Test your own configuration privately before you rely on it.
